Police officers in Erewash are appealing for anyone with information about an assault in Kirk Hallam to contact them as part of an investigation.
A call was received shortly before 7pm on Monday 9th October to report an assault in Godfrey Drive after a van collided with a black Vauxhall Astra before going onto a grass verge and hitting a man.
An investigation has been launched into the incident with increased patrols deployed to the area over the following days.
The incident is being treated as isolated and there is not thought to be a wider threat to the community, however, residents have been told that they should raise any concerns with any officers seen in the area.
As part of the investigation, police officers are appealing for anyone who witnessed what happened or has any CCTV or dashcam footage, to contact them as the information could be vital to enquiries.
